summaryrefslogtreecommitdiff
path: root/libgphoto2_port/vusb
Commit message (Expand)AuthorAgeFilesLines
* generic usb fuzzingMarcus Meissner2019-04-233-4/+38
* add a generic fuzz mode we can use for other camerasMarcus Meissner2019-01-263-0/+17
* on EOF on fuzzd return io errors for USB interrupts tooMarcus Meissner2019-01-261-0/+2
* fixed string generatorMarcus Meissner2019-01-201-1/+1
* fixed nikon_setcontrolmode returnMarcus Meissner2019-01-201-6/+0
* eof == read errorMarcus Meissner2019-01-201-1/+1
* handle empty stringsMarcus Meissner2019-01-141-2/+6
* Handle usb_msg_read as forward to _read for nowMarcus Meissner2017-07-312-5/+7
* enlarge stack buffer a bit to satisfy size constraints andMarcus Meissner2017-06-011-2/+2
* added exposurebiasMarcus Meissner2017-04-132-1/+54
* implement PTP FNumber emulationMarcus Meissner2017-04-132-0/+59
* add virtual PTP shutterspeed (ExposureTime / 0x500D)Marcus Meissner2017-04-132-1/+50
* stat the replacement DCIM directory to avoid bad dataMarcus Meissner2017-04-131-0/+2
* copyright headersMarcus Meissner2017-02-172-4/+2
* do not wait in event handling when fuzzingMarcus Meissner2017-01-061-0/+6
* incorrect array index (AFL)Marcus Meissner2017-01-031-1/+1
* shorten the strings for the fuzzer to have a smaller corpusMarcus Meissner2016-12-111-8/+8
* handle short readsMarcus Meissner2016-12-091-0/+3
* use gp_system_filename() for Windowspeterbud2016-11-191-5/+5
* some signed -> unsigned fixes in fuzz readerMarcus Meissner2016-10-292-3/+3
* also use the read block size from the fuzzer file.Marcus Meissner2016-10-293-15/+40
* in fuzz mode be less strict with opcodesMarcus Meissner2016-10-291-2/+8
* take input directly from the fuzzer, no xorMarcus Meissner2016-09-242-12/+33
* vusb pretend to by a d750Marcus Meissner2016-05-121-1/+1
* select deviceinfo on typeMarcus Meissner2016-03-131-2/+10
* start to add support for multiple camera typesMarcus Meissner2016-03-133-23/+98
* add support for a enum range with strings (ImageFormat)Marcus Meissner2016-02-281-2/+32
* allow fuzzing the virtual usb traffic, with a file being xored.Marcus Meissner2016-02-223-5/+26
* do not check the return of the gp_port_info_list_append in genericMarcus Meissner2016-02-071-1/+1
* avoid memory leak in vcameraMarcus Meissner2016-01-131-1/+6
* avoid leaking data on error exit (Coverity)Marcus Meissner2016-01-101-2/+1
* free data in error exit paths (Coverity)Marcus Meissner2016-01-101-0/+2
* free opcodes and devprops (Coverity)Marcus Meissner2016-01-101-0/+2
* remove more unistd.h inclusions that are not neededMarcus Meissner2016-01-032-2/+0
* use gp_system_*dir functions instead of the bare readdir/opendir/closedirMarcus Meissner2016-01-031-5/+6
* document capture and delete being virtualMarcus Meissner2015-12-271-0/+5
* document 9999 opcodeMarcus Meissner2015-12-271-0/+9
* allow timeout setting with the 0x9999 command, its the second argumentMarcus Meissner2015-12-271-4/+16
* 9999,2 emits a capture complete eventMarcus Meissner2015-12-271-0/+4
* whitespace adjustmentMarcus Meissner2015-12-231-1/+1
* report objectremoved event tooMarcus Meissner2015-12-231-4/+5
* add a vcamera specific opcode 9999 which can be used to generateMarcus Meissner2015-12-231-0/+112
* implement sending data to the cameraMarcus Meissner2015-12-232-38/+170
* increment capcnt even on storefull eventMarcus Meissner2015-12-131-1/+1
* emit a storefull error, bothj as return code and during captureMarcus Meissner2015-12-131-3/+34
* create a new directory every 100 captured images, including objectaddedMarcus Meissner2015-12-131-5/+54
* check parameters of initatecaptureMarcus Meissner2015-12-121-1/+14
* report captureformats, report capturecompleteeventMarcus Meissner2015-12-111-2/+5
* first working initiatecapture versionMarcus Meissner2015-12-111-3/+45
* missing breakMarcus Meissner2015-12-111-0/+3